Ecover, the eco-friendly cleaning brand, is to embark on live marketing activity at UK festivals...The brand has appointed experiential agency Closer to handle the activity, which will run at family-focused festivals Cornbury in Oxfordshire, Latitude in Suffolk, and Camp Bestival in Dorset ...
